Google’s Massive NYC Android Ad

AlleyWatch by AlleyWatch
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Google’s 25,000-foot digital billboard, launched on Nov. 24, is the size of an entire city block and has a ridiculous pixel density. Avoid the trip to Times Square and see the monstrous billboard here.
